Jigsaw Puzzles and Brain Health: 6 Cognitive Benefits Backed by Science

Jigsaw puzzles have been around since the 1760s, and their appeal has outlasted every technology that was supposed to replace them. There's a reason. Beyond the obvious satisfaction of completing a 1,000-piece landscape, jigsaw puzzles engage the brain in ways that are increasingly well-understood by cognitive scientists. Here's what the research shows.

1. They exercise both hemispheres simultaneously

Most activities are predominantly left-brain (logical, sequential, language-based) or right-brain (spatial, creative, visual). Jigsaw puzzles are unusual in demanding both at the same time. Identifying the correct piece requires spatial reasoning and visual pattern recognition (right hemisphere), while the systematic approach of sorting by color, edge, or pattern is a logical, analytical process (left hemisphere).

This bilateral engagement is one reason jigsaw puzzles are used in cognitive rehabilitation programs — they create neural demand across multiple systems simultaneously.

2. They improve short-term memory

When you're searching for a specific piece, you hold a mental image of the piece's shape, color, and approximate position in the picture while scanning hundreds of options. This is a direct workout for visual short-term memory — the same system that helps you remember faces, navigate spaces, and retain visual information from reading.

A 2019 study in Frontiers in Aging Neuroscience found that regular jigsaw puzzle solvers showed better spatial cognition and short-term visual memory compared to non-solvers across multiple age groups.

3. They reduce cortisol and induce flow states

Jigsaw puzzles are one of the few activities that consistently induce the psychological state known as "flow" — deep, focused engagement with a task that feels both challenging and manageable. During flow states, the stress hormone cortisol drops, and dopamine — associated with reward and learning — rises. This combination creates the pleasant, almost meditative quality that regular puzzlers describe and explains why many people find puzzling genuinely relaxing despite it being cognitively demanding.

4. They build problem-solving patience

Jigsaw puzzles cannot be rushed. You cannot skip steps or brute-force solutions. The only path forward is patient, systematic observation. Regular puzzlers develop what psychologists call "tolerance for ambiguity" — the ability to sit with an unsolved problem without anxiety. This patience transfers to other domains: work problems, relationship challenges, learning new skills.

5. They support visuospatial reasoning

Visuospatial reasoning — the ability to mentally manipulate objects, understand spatial relationships, and navigate environments — is one of the cognitive abilities most sensitive to aging. Research consistently shows that activities requiring spatial reasoning, including jigsaw puzzles, help maintain this capacity longer. Engineers, architects, and surgeons, who rely on visuospatial reasoning professionally, show above-average retention of this skill in later life — and puzzling is one activity associated with that retention.

6. They're a social activity

Despite their reputation as solo pursuits, jigsaw puzzles are frequently done cooperatively — families around a dining table, couples working together on weekends, friends visiting over a puzzle in progress. Collaborative puzzling combines the cognitive benefits with social engagement, which is independently associated with better cognitive aging outcomes. The puzzle provides a shared focus that facilitates conversation without demanding it.

Getting started

If you're new to jigsaw puzzles, start with 300–500 pieces and an image with high color variety — landscapes with distinct sections are easier than abstract patterns or photographs of water.
